I have made a wos search and these are the clusters I have got. Is it possible to increase the number of clusters visualized, in this case more than 10??
There is one cluster that is far from the other but I can't see the label neither I am able to add one. Can someone help me with this?
By default, CiteSpace only labels clusters that belong to the largest connected component of the network. To get labels for more clusters, Filters > Show largest k connected components, e.g. with a k=3, 4, 5, ... You can also leave the first 2 boxes unchecked, then run the cluster labeling process after you change the setting.
